經典冒泡排序,數值升序排列

public class Order {

// 數值從小到大排序

/* 1,冒泡排序 */

private static int[] array = new int[] { 1, 2, 9, 5, 6, 7, 0, 10 };

private static int[] order(int[] array) {
    int temp; //設置中間值
    int size = array.length;
    for (int i = 0; i < size - 1; i++) {
        for (int j = i + 1; j < size; j++) {
            if (array[i] > array[j]) { //交換數值
                temp = array[j];
                array[j] = array[i];
                array[i] = temp;
            }
        }
    }
    return array;
}

public static void main(String[] args) {
    array = order(array);
    for(int i:array){
        System.out.print(i+" , ");
    }
}

}

發表評論
所有評論
還沒有人評論,想成為第一個評論的人麼? 請在上方評論欄輸入並且點擊發布.
相關文章